Ep20 - Bradley the Solo Shanty Man
Matt welcomes Bradley the Solo Shanty Man to The Open Mic Room. Uncover the surprisingly vibrant world of shanty singing — and how a former chef turned solo performer is bringing it to life in Devon and beyond. Bradley, aka "The Solo Shanty Man," reveals how he transitioned from a 15-year culinary career to capturing audiences with the raw energy of maritime folk music. Discover the stories behind iconic shanties like No Hopers Jokers and Rogues and learn why these songs remain timeless.You'll explore:How traditional sea shanties have evolved, mixing old classics with modern tunes like Eagles' Seven Bridges RoadThe role of crowd participation in creating a genuine maritime atmosphere — and tips to get your audience singing alongThe impact of groups like Fisherman's Friends on popularizing shanty music, with insights into their influence on tourism and local culture in CornwallBradley's plans for Shanties by Candlelight, a unique series in historic churches, blending spiritual ambiance with lively maritime storytellingThe challenges small artists face in booking gigs and maintaining the camaraderie that keeps shanty traditions aliveThis episode is perfect for music lovers craving authentic performances, folk enthusiasts, or anyone curious about how maritime culture keeps sailing strong today. Bradley’s engaging storytelling and candid insights will inspire you to see both the seas and folk music in a whole new light.Whether you’re a seasoned sailor or just passionate about community-driven music, this conversation will leave you hooked on the charm and resilience of shanties.
